How to fill out instrument - polst

How to fill out an instrument - POLST:
01
Start by obtaining a copy of the POLST form. You can ask your healthcare provider or find it online.
02
Read the instructions carefully to understand the purpose and components of the form. Make sure you are familiar with the medical terms used.
03
Begin by filling out the personal information section, including the patient's name, date of birth, and contact information.
04
Move on to the section where you will indicate the patient's medical condition. You may need to consult with the healthcare provider to accurately fill in this information.
05
The next step is to decide and document the patient's treatment preferences. This includes their goals of care, such as whether they want life-sustaining treatments, such as CPR or mechanical ventilation.
06
Indicate any specific medical interventions the patient wants or does not want. These may include hospitalization, antibiotics, or artificial nutrition and hydration.
07
If the patient has appointed a healthcare agent or proxy, provide their contact information. This person will be responsible for making medical decisions on behalf of the patient if they cannot express their preferences.
08
Once you have completed filling out the form, review it carefully to ensure accuracy. Make any necessary corrections or additions.
09
The final step is to sign and date the form. The patient should sign if they are capable, and if not, the healthcare agent or proxy can sign on their behalf.
Who needs an instrument - POLST:
01
Individuals with serious or advanced illnesses who have specific preferences regarding medical treatments and interventions.
02
Patients who are nearing the end of life or have chronic conditions that may require medical interventions in the future.
03
Healthcare providers who need clear instructions on a patient's treatment preferences to ensure their wishes are honored.
04
Family members or caregivers who may need guidance on making healthcare decisions for their loved ones.
Remember, the POLST form is a legal document and should be kept in a readily accessible location, such as in a patient's medical records or on their person, to ensure healthcare providers can follow the documented preferences during an emergency.

What is instrument - polst?
The instrument - POLST stands for Physician Orders for Life-Sustaining Treatment. It is a medical order that outlines a patient's wishes regarding medical treatment.
Who is required to file instrument - polst?
The instrument - POLST is typically completed by a patient in consultation with their healthcare provider.
How to fill out instrument - polst?
The instrument - POLST should be completed by the patient or their healthcare proxy, in consultation with their healthcare provider. It includes decisions about CPR, intubation, and other life-sustaining treatments.
What is the purpose of instrument - polst?
The purpose of the instrument - POLST is to ensure that a patient's wishes regarding medical treatment are honored, especially in emergency situations.
What information must be reported on instrument - polst?
The instrument - POLST should include information about the patient's preferences for CPR, intubation, and other life-sustaining treatments, as well as any do-not-resuscitate orders.
